If a router does not know where to forward a packet, what does it do with the packet?

Explanation:
When a router handles a packet, it first checks its routing table to find the next hop for the destination. If there is no entry that matches the destination, the router has no path to forward the packet. In this situation, the correct action is to drop the packet so it isn’t sent into the network without a known route. Some devices may also send back an ICMP Destination Unreachable message to inform the sender, but the essential behavior is to discard when no route exists. The other options don’t fit: forwarding to all interfaces would cause unnecessary broadcast traffic and potential loops; sending to a default gateway only happens if a default route exists, which isn’t guaranteed when no route is known; encryption has no role in deciding how to forward or drop a packet.
